Login sound stops before it's finished on my system too. Was doing it in HH, and I believe it's related to KDE. I don't have the problem in HH KDE 3.5.10 or GG KDE 3.5.9.
What's happening, I believe, is that some other startup process is interrupting the login sound. Interestingly, the same is not true when logging out. It's a minor annoyance, but really should be fixed.

Still searching for "System Notifications" under System Settings... I have no such thing under either the General or Advanced tab. I have looked in each control, and I cannot find it anywhere. I may be the dumbest person should it be staring me in the face, but I have been using *buntu for about two years now, and I cannot find it for the life of me.
K Menu > System Settings > Notifications > System Notifications > Event Source > KDE System Notifications.
